: The installer bundled massive amounts of third-party advertising software, such as Claria (Gator).

: Users often unknowingly agreed to install pop-up generators and system monitors during the setup process.

: The official website and service ceased operations by August 2012 following years of copyright-related litigation. The "Cost" of Free Kazaa

: By 2003, it had over 220 million downloads and approximately 14 million unique users.

⚠️ : Since Kazaa is defunct, any modern site claiming to offer a "free Kazaa" download is highly likely to be a source of malware or phishing. For modern alternatives, users typically look to community-driven projects like Soulseek or established legal streaming platforms.
